Currently, the Home Office … WebPolish citizenship law is based on the “right of blood”, “ Jus sanguinis “. That is; if you are of Polish descent, you may obtain Polish citizenship and passport on this basis. WebArmenian nationality law is regulated by the Constitution of Armenia, as amended; the Citizenship Law of Armenia and its revisions; and various international agreements to which the country is a signatory. These laws determine who is, or is eligible to be, an Armenian national.
